Web14 dec. 2024 · Cobalt. Riding the lithium-ion battery high is cobalt, with most of the world’s supply arising out of the Democratic Republic of Congo (DRC). The US Geological Survey claims DRC contributed 66,000t to global cobalt supplies in 2016, which is more than half the world’s 123,000t produced that year. Web1 mrt. 2024 · Therefore the maximum power that a Tesla battery pack can can use for charging is 4.2 X N X I where N is the number of cells in the pack and I is the maximum current allowed per cell. For 85/90 kWh packs this is 7,104 X 16.8=119.3 kW. For the 100 kWh packs it is 8,256 X 16.8=138.7 kW.

Web3 apr. 2024 · Lithium-metal anodes are regarded as key elements for battery systems of the future. They enable the energy density to be maximized both in terms of cell volume and mass. The lithium metal anode is already being used in lithium sulfur cells to achieve record specific energy values of more than 400 watt hours per kilogram. Lithium-ion batteries can be a safety hazard since they contain a flammable electrolyte and may become pressurized if they become damaged. A battery cell charged too quickly could cause a short circuit, leading to explosions and fires. WebHow to make lithium grease. The process to make simple lithium soap grease. See the above examples for composition or formulation. Add the initial base oil (40-60% of total base oil) to an open kettle, start heating and mixing. Heat to 80-84°C (176-183°F) Add all the 12-HSA and HCO in any order and allow it to melt.
